Step‑by‑Step Instructions for The Ultimate Strawberry Cheesecake Dump Cake
Step 1: Prepare the Pan
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9×13 inch baking dish with butter or cooking spray. This ensures your cake won’t stick and allows for easy serving. A well-greased pan adds to the ensured golden crust of The Ultimate Strawberry Cheesecake Dump Cake, making the perfect foundation for the layers ahead.
Step 2: Layer Ingredients
Begin assembling your dump cake by pouring the strawberry pie filling evenly across the bottom of the prepared dish. Next, in a separate bowl, mix together softened cream cheese and whipped topping until smooth and creamy. Carefully spoon this luscious mixture over the strawberry layer, ensuring it spreads evenly. Finally, sprinkle the dry yellow cake mix over the cream cheese layer, creating a beautiful base for the cake.
Step 3: Drizzle Butter
Melt one cup of butter and drizzle it evenly over the dry cake mix. This step is crucial—make sure to cover all areas of the cake mix to avoid any dry spots. The melted butter will meld with the cake mix in the oven, contributing to the rich flavor and a crunchy topping that brings out the best in The Ultimate Strawberry Cheesecake Dump Cake.
Step 4: Bake
Place the dish in the preheated oven and bake for 45 minutes, or until the top turns golden brown and a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Keep an eye on it—baking times may vary slightly. As the dump cake bakes, your kitchen will fill with the delicious aromas of strawberry and cheesecake, heightening anticipation for this delightful dessert.
Step 5: Cool and Serve
Once baked, remove the dump cake from the oven and let it cool for at least 15 minutes. This cooling period helps the layers to set. How to Store and Freeze The Ultimate Strawberry Cheesecake Dump Cake
Fridge: Store any leftovers in an airtight container for up to 5 days. This cake actually improves in flavor overnight, making it a delightful make-ahead dessert.
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the dump cake by wrapping it tightly in plastic wrap, then in aluminum foil, for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before serving.
Reheating: Reheat individual servings in the microwave for about 20-30 seconds, just until warm. Top with whipped cream for a fresh touch on The Ultimate Strawberry Cheesecake Dump Cake.

The Ultimate Strawberry Cheesecake Dump Cake You’ll Love
Ingredients
Equipment
Method
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9×13 inch baking dish with butter or cooking spray.
- Pour the strawberry pie filling evenly across the bottom of the prepared dish.
- Mix together softened cream cheese and whipped topping until smooth and creamy; spoon this over the strawberry layer.
- Sprinkle the dry yellow cake mix over the cream cheese layer.
- Melt one cup of butter and drizzle it evenly over the dry cake mix.
- Bake for 45 minutes, or until the top turns golden brown and a toothpick inserted comes out clean.
- Remove the dump cake from the oven and let it cool for at least 15 minutes before serving.
